ndbsyj.com

专业资讯与知识分享平台

边缘计算:驱动数字化转型的关键技术架构与编程实践

📌 文章摘要
本文深入探讨边缘计算在现代信息技术体系中的核心角色与战略价值。我们将从技术咨询视角,解析边缘计算如何重构数据处理范式,支撑企业数字化转型;同时探讨其背后的关键编程模型与实践,为技术决策者与开发者提供兼具深度与实用性的指南,助力构建更高效、可靠且智能的下一代IT基础设施。

1. 从中心到边缘:数字化转型下的计算范式重构

在数字化转型的浪潮中,企业对实时性、可靠性和数据隐私的需求达到了前所未有的高度。传统的集中式云计算模型,虽然提供了强大的弹性算力,但在处理物联网(IoT)、工业互联网、自动驾驶等场景产生的海量、实时数据时,往往面临网络延迟、带宽瓶颈和数据安全风险。边缘计算应运而生,它并非取代云计算,而是对其进行关键性补充与延伸。 边缘计算的核心思想是将计算、存储和分析能力从云端的数据中心,下沉到更靠近数据源或用户的网络‘边缘’侧。这些‘边缘’可以是工厂车间、零售门店、智能楼宇,甚至是自动驾驶汽车本身。通过这种架构重构,企业能够实现:1)**超低延迟响应**:关键业务逻辑在本地毫秒级处理,满足工业控制、实时交互等严苛要求;2)**带宽优化**:在边缘进行数据预处理与过滤,仅将有价值的信息上传至云端,极大节省网络成本;3)**数据隐私与合规**:敏感数据可在本地处理,避免不必要的网络传输,更符合数据主权法规(如GDPR)。从技术咨询角度看,采纳边缘计算已成为企业构建韧性数字基础设施、解锁实时智能应用的战略选择。

2. 技术架构与核心组件:构建稳健的边缘计算体系

一个完整的边缘计算体系通常包含三个逻辑层次:边缘设备层、边缘节点/网关层和云端中心层。成功的部署离不开对以下核心组件的深入理解与技术选型: 1. **边缘硬件**:从资源受限的嵌入式传感器、工控机,到功能强大的边缘服务器,硬件选型需平衡算力、功耗、环境适应性与成本。ARM架构与x86架构的竞争在此领域尤为突出。 2. **边缘软件与平台**:这是技术落地的关键。包括轻量级容器运行时(如Docker, containerd)、边缘编排框架(如Kubernetes的K3s、KubeEdge)、边缘函数计算平台以及设备管理软件。它们负责应用的部署、生命周期管理、资源调度以及与云端的协同。 3. **通信与网络**:边缘计算依赖稳定、多样的网络连接,包括5G、Wi-Fi 6、LoRa等。边云协同需要高效的同步机制与协议(如MQTT、HTTP/3),以保障数据与指令的可靠、安全传输。 技术咨询的价值在于,帮助企业根据其具体的业务场景(如预测性维护、智慧零售、视频分析),规划合理的架构分层,选择匹配的技术栈,并设计高可用的边云协同策略,避免陷入‘为边缘而边缘’的技术陷阱。

3. 边缘计算下的编程模型与开发实践

边缘计算对软件开发提出了新的挑战与机遇。编程思维需从‘云原生’向‘边云协同原生’演进。以下是关键实践方向: - **轻量化与模块化设计**:边缘设备资源有限,要求应用镜像尽可能小,启动速度快。开发者需精通构建精简容器镜像(如使用Alpine基础镜像、多阶段构建),并采用微服务或函数(FaaS)架构,将应用拆分为独立部署、可复用的模块。 - **状态管理与离线运行**:网络不稳定是边缘常态。编程时必须考虑应用的离线自治能力,采用本地数据库(如SQLite、EdgeDB)进行状态持久化,并在网络恢复时实现与云端数据的优雅同步。 - **边缘智能推理**:将经过云端训练的AI模型轻量化(通过剪枝、量化、知识蒸馏等技术)后部署至边缘,实现本地实时推理。这要求开发者熟悉TensorFlow Lite、PyTorch Mobile或ONNX Runtime等边缘推理框架。 - **安全编程**:边缘环境物理暴露风险高。编程时需贯穿安全原则,包括固件安全更新、硬件安全模块(HSM)集成、数据端到端加密,以及最小权限的访问控制。 对于开发者而言,掌握Go、Rust(适用于高性能、安全的系统级编程)和Python(适用于快速原型与AI集成)等语言,并熟悉上述边缘特定框架,将成为重要的竞争力。

4. 战略价值与未来展望:边缘计算赋能行业新生态

边缘计算的最终价值在于赋能业务创新与效率革命。在制造业,它使实时质量检测与预测性维护成为可能,减少停机损失;在零售业,支持基于店内摄像头的实时客流分析与个性化推荐;在智慧城市,助力交通流量优化与公共安全监控。 从战略层面看,边缘计算正与5G、人工智能、数字孪生深度融合,推动计算无所不在的‘泛在计算’时代到来。未来,我们将看到更加自治的‘边缘智能体’,能够自主决策与协作;边缘市场的标准化与开源生态将进一步成熟,降低部署复杂度;同时,边缘安全、边缘应用的商业模式也将持续创新。 对于正在进行数字化转型的企业,将边缘计算纳入整体IT战略规划已非可选,而是必然。通过专业的技术咨询,厘清业务需求,采用恰当的编程与架构实践,企业能够率先构建起面向未来的、云边端一体化的智能系统,在数据驱动的竞争中赢得关键优势。